摘要
第20届国际沉积学大会于2018年8月13日—17日在加拿大魁北克城召开。来自51个国家、930余名专家学者参加了本次会议。基于本届大会论文专题设置情况,指出目前沉积学研究热点主要包含人类世沉积学、湖泊沉积环境、深水沉积过程、"源—汇"系统、微生物岩沉积学及沉积过程模拟等多个主要方面。当前人类活动对地貌影响、沉积物收支平衡影响不容忽视;湖泊沉积砂体研究不仅具有油气勘探价值,而且对古气候研究具有重要意义;沉积深水重力流的流态特征、沉积机理及实地监测等研究取得较大进展;"源—汇"系统研究思想在盆地构造演化、源区母岩性质及沉积物分散样式等方面具有更加实际的指导意义;微生物岩沉积学研究进展包括微生物矿化作用、成岩作用及其对于古地理重建的意义等方面;沉积物风化过程及其在不同环境下搬运及沉积过程是目前沉积学物理、数值模拟的主要内容。就近年来国际沉积学会议热点以及国际重点地质研究计划的实施情况来看,认为深时沉积记录、过程—产物研究方法、多学科交叉渗透是未来若干年内沉积学的发展方向。我国当今沉积学研究以应用沉积学为主,除了重视现代实验分析技术,还应加强野外基本地质研究方法和沉积过程机理研究。在沉积学快速发展的黄金时期,应抓住难得的机遇,不断将我国沉积学研究推向国际先进水平。
        The 20~(th) International Sedimentological Congress was held in Quebec City( Canada) from August 13~(th) to 17~(th) in 2018. 931 scholars from 51 countries attended this conference. According to the arrangement of sessions in the conference,the current hot topics contain Anthropocene sedimentology,lacustrine sedimentology,deep-water sedimentary process,"source-to-sink"system,microbialites and the simulation of sedimentary process et al. The anthropic influence on modern geomorphological characteristics cannot be unneglected. The study of lacustrine sandbodies is not only meaningful for petroleum exploration and development but also has great implications for paleoclimate. Flow characteristics,sedimentary process and situ monitoring of deep-water sediment gravity flows have made great achievements in recent years. "Source-to-sink"perspectives are instructive to tectonic evolution of sedimentary basin,the nature of parent rocks from provenance area and the sedimentary dispersal characteristics. The recent advancement of microbialites mainly consists of mineralization and diagenesis of microorganisms and their implications for the reconstruction of paleoclimate. The weathering of sedimentary rocks as well as subsequent transportation and sedimentation in different depositional environments have become the main research focus of physical and numerical simulation. According to hot topics of recent meetings of sedimentology and the implementation of major geological plans,deep-time depositional record,process-product study,multidisciplinary investigation will be development directions of sedimentary research in the following years. Current sedimentary research in our country still concentrates on applied sedimentology,we not only pay much attention to modern experimental and testing technology,but also to fundamental field work and mechanism of sedimentary process.
